Road Crack Repair in Orange County, CA
Road crack repair services focus on restoring the integrity and appearance of asphalt or concrete surfaces that have developed cracks due to age, weather, or ground movement. These repairs are suitable for a variety of projects, including driveways, parking lots, walkways, and residential pathways. Property owners typically seek these services to prevent further deterioration, improve safety, and enhance curb appeal by sealing existing cracks and preventing water intrusion that can lead to more extensive damage.
Before requesting crack repair, homeowners should consider the extent and size of the cracks, as well as the overall condition of the surface. Understanding whether cracks are surface-level or indicative of deeper structural issues helps determine the appropriate repair method. Additionally, knowing the type of surface material and any specific project requirements can ensure the chosen repair approach effectively addresses current problems and prolongs the lifespan of the pavement or concrete.

Road Crack Repair Questions
What types of cracks can be repaired? Common cracks such as surface, longitudinal, and transverse can be effectively sealed to prevent further damage.
Is crack repair suitable for all driveway materials? Most asphalt and concrete surfaces can undergo crack repair to restore their integrity and appearance.
What are the benefits of repairing driveway cracks? Repairing cracks helps maintain the driveway’s safety, appearance, and prevents more costly repairs later.
What projects typically require crack repair? Crack repair is often needed for residential driveways, parking areas, and walkways showing signs of cracking or deterioration.
